V8 Project
v8::internal::Isolate Member List

This is the complete list of members for v8::internal::Isolate, including all inherited members.

AddCallCompletedCallback(CallCompletedCallback callback)v8::internal::Isolate
AddressId enum namev8::internal::Isolate
ArchiveSpacePerThread()v8::internal::Isolateinlinestatic
ArchiveThread(char *to)v8::internal::Isolate
basic_block_profiler()v8::internal::Isolateinline
basic_block_profiler_v8::internal::Isolateprivate
bootstrapper()v8::internal::Isolateinline
bootstrapper_v8::internal::Isolateprivate
break_access()v8::internal::Isolateinline
break_access_v8::internal::Isolateprivate
builtins()v8::internal::Isolateinline
builtins_v8::internal::Isolateprivate
c_entry_fp(ThreadLocalTop *thread)v8::internal::Isolateinlinestatic
c_entry_fp_address()v8::internal::Isolateinline
call_completed_callbacks_v8::internal::Isolateprivate
call_descriptor_data(int index)v8::internal::Isolate
call_descriptor_data_v8::internal::Isolateprivate
CancelScheduledExceptionFromTryCatch(v8::TryCatch *handler)v8::internal::Isolate
CancelTerminateExecution()v8::internal::Isolate
capture_stack_trace_for_uncaught_exceptions_v8::internal::Isolateprivate
CaptureAndSetDetailedStackTrace(Handle< JSObject > error_object)v8::internal::Isolate
CaptureAndSetSimpleStackTrace(Handle< JSObject > error_object, Handle< Object > caller)v8::internal::Isolate
CaptureCurrentStackTrace(int frame_limit, StackTrace::StackTraceOptions options)v8::internal::Isolate
CaptureSimpleStackTrace(Handle< JSObject > error_object, Handle< Object > caller)v8::internal::Isolate
clear_pending_exception()v8::internal::Isolateinline
clear_pending_message()v8::internal::Isolateinline
clear_scheduled_exception()v8::internal::Isolateinline
code_aging_helper()v8::internal::Isolateinline
code_aging_helper_v8::internal::Isolateprivate
code_range()v8::internal::Isolateinline
code_range_v8::internal::Isolateprivate
compilation_cache()v8::internal::Isolateinline
compilation_cache_v8::internal::Isolateprivate
ComputeLocation(MessageLocation *target)v8::internal::Isolate
concurrent_osr_enabled() constv8::internal::Isolateinline
concurrent_recompilation_enabled()v8::internal::Isolateinline
context()v8::internal::Isolateinline
context_address()v8::internal::Isolateinline
context_slot_cache()v8::internal::Isolateinline
context_slot_cache_v8::internal::Isolateprivate
counters()v8::internal::Isolateinline
counters_v8::internal::Isolateprivate
CountUsage(v8::Isolate::UseCounterFeature feature)v8::internal::Isolate
cpu_profiler() constv8::internal::Isolateinline
cpu_profiler_v8::internal::Isolateprivate
CurrentPerIsolateThreadData()v8::internal::Isolateinlinestatic
date_cache()v8::internal::Isolateinline
date_cache_v8::internal::Isolateprivate
debug()v8::internal::Isolateinline
debug_v8::internal::Isolateprivate
debugger_initialized_v8::internal::Isolateprivate
DebuggerHasBreakPoints()v8::internal::Isolateinline
deferred_handles_head_v8::internal::Isolateprivate
Deinit()v8::internal::Isolateprivate
deoptimizer_data()v8::internal::Isolateinline
deoptimizer_data_v8::internal::Isolateprivate
descriptor_lookup_cache()v8::internal::Isolateinline
descriptor_lookup_cache_v8::internal::Isolateprivate
DISALLOW_COPY_AND_ASSIGN(Isolate)v8::internal::Isolateprivate
DoThrow(Object *exception, MessageLocation *location)v8::internal::Isolate
embedder_data_v8::internal::Isolateprivate
enable_serializer()v8::internal::Isolateinline
EnqueueMicrotask(Handle< Object > microtask)v8::internal::Isolate
Enter()v8::internal::Isolateprivate
entry_stack_v8::internal::Isolateprivate
eternal_handles()v8::internal::Isolateinline
eternal_handles_v8::internal::Isolateprivate
ExecutionAccess classv8::internal::Isolatefriend
Exit()v8::internal::Isolateprivate
external_caught_exception_address()v8::internal::Isolateinline
factory()v8::internal::Isolateinline
FillCache()v8::internal::Isolateprivate
FindCodeObject(Address a)v8::internal::Isolate
FindOrAllocatePerThreadDataForThisThread()v8::internal::Isolateprivate
FindPerThreadDataForThisThread()v8::internal::Isolate
FindPerThreadDataForThread(ThreadId thread_id)v8::internal::Isolate
FireCallCompletedCallback()v8::internal::Isolate
formal_count_address()v8::internal::Isolateinline
FreeThreadResources()v8::internal::Isolateinline
function_entry_hook()v8::internal::Isolateinline
function_entry_hook_v8::internal::Isolateprivate
get_address_from_id(AddressId id)v8::internal::Isolate
get_initial_js_array_map(ElementsKind kind)v8::internal::Isolate
GetCallingNativeContext()v8::internal::Isolate
GetCodeTracer()v8::internal::Isolate
GetData(uint32_t slot)v8::internal::Isolateinline
GetHStatistics()v8::internal::Isolate
GetHTracer()v8::internal::Isolate
GetMessageLocation()v8::internal::Isolate
GetOrCreateBasicBlockProfiler()v8::internal::Isolate
GetPromiseOnStackOnThrow()v8::internal::Isolate
GetSymbolRegistry()v8::internal::Isolate
GetTStatistics()v8::internal::Isolate
global_context()v8::internal::Isolate
global_handles()v8::internal::Isolateinline
global_handles_v8::internal::Isolateprivate
global_object()v8::internal::Isolateinline
global_proxy()v8::internal::Isolateinline
GlobalStatev8::internal::Isolatefriend
GlobalTearDown()v8::internal::Isolatestatic
handle_scope_data()v8::internal::Isolateinline
handle_scope_data_v8::internal::Isolateprivate
handle_scope_implementer()v8::internal::Isolateinline
handle_scope_implementer_v8::internal::Isolateprivate
handler(ThreadLocalTop *thread)v8::internal::Isolateinlinestatic
handler_address()v8::internal::Isolateinline
HandleScopeImplementer classv8::internal::Isolatefriend
has_fatal_error_v8::internal::Isolateprivate
has_installed_extensions()v8::internal::Isolateinline
has_installed_extensions_v8::internal::Isolateprivate
has_pending_exception()v8::internal::Isolateinline
has_pending_message_address()v8::internal::Isolateinline
has_scheduled_exception()v8::internal::Isolateinline
HasExternalTryCatch()v8::internal::Isolate
heap()v8::internal::Isolateinline
heap_v8::internal::Isolateprivate
heap_profiler() constv8::internal::Isolateinline
heap_profiler_v8::internal::Isolateprivate
id() constv8::internal::Isolateinline
id_v8::internal::Isolateprivate
incomplete_message_v8::internal::Isolateprivate
Init(Deserializer *des)v8::internal::Isolate
INITIALIZED enum valuev8::internal::Isolateprivate
initialized_from_snapshot()v8::internal::Isolateinline
initialized_from_snapshot_v8::internal::Isolateprivate
InitializeGlobalStatev8::internal::Isolatefriend
InitializeLoggingAndCounters()v8::internal::Isolate
InitializeOncePerProcess()v8::internal::Isolatestatic
InitializeThreadLocal()v8::internal::Isolateprivate
INLINE(static Isolate *Current())v8::internal::Isolateinline
INLINE(static Isolate *UncheckedCurrent())v8::internal::Isolateinline
INLINE(static Isolate *UnsafeCurrent())v8::internal::Isolateinline
inner_pointer_to_code_cache()v8::internal::Isolateinline
inner_pointer_to_code_cache_v8::internal::Isolateprivate
interp_canonicalize_mapping()v8::internal::Isolateinline
interp_canonicalize_mapping_v8::internal::Isolateprivate
InvokeApiInterruptCallback()v8::internal::Isolate
is_catchable_by_javascript(Object *exception)v8::internal::Isolateinline
IsDead()v8::internal::Isolateinline
IsErrorObject(Handle< Object > obj)v8::internal::Isolateprivate
IsFastArrayConstructorPrototypeChainIntact()v8::internal::Isolate
IsFinallyOnTop()v8::internal::Isolate
IsInitialized()v8::internal::Isolateinline
IsInUse()v8::internal::Isolateinline
Isolate()v8::internal::Isolateprivate
isolate_addresses_v8::internal::Isolateprivate
isolate_counter_v8::internal::Isolateprivatestatic
isolate_key()v8::internal::Isolateinlinestatic
isolate_key_v8::internal::Isolateprivatestatic
IsolateInitializer classv8::internal::Isolatefriend
Iterate(ObjectVisitor *v)v8::internal::Isolate
Iterate(ObjectVisitor *v, ThreadLocalTop *t)v8::internal::Isolate
Iterate(ObjectVisitor *v, char *t)v8::internal::Isolate
IterateDeferredHandles(ObjectVisitor *visitor)v8::internal::Isolate
IterateThread(ThreadVisitor *v, char *t)v8::internal::Isolate
js_builtins_object()v8::internal::Isolateinline
js_entry_sp()v8::internal::Isolateinline
js_entry_sp_address()v8::internal::Isolateinline
jsregexp_canonrange()v8::internal::Isolateinline
jsregexp_canonrange_v8::internal::Isolateprivate
jsregexp_uncanonicalize()v8::internal::Isolateinline
jsregexp_uncanonicalize_v8::internal::Isolateprivate
kBMMaxShiftv8::internal::Isolatestatic
keyed_lookup_cache()v8::internal::Isolateinline
keyed_lookup_cache_v8::internal::Isolateprivate
kIsolateAddressCount enum valuev8::internal::Isolate
kJSRegexpStaticOffsetsVectorSizev8::internal::Isolatestatic
kStackOverflowMessagev8::internal::Isolatestatic
kUC16AlphabetSizev8::internal::Isolatestatic
LinkDeferredHandles(DeferredHandles *deferred_handles)v8::internal::Isolate
logger()v8::internal::Isolateinline
logger_v8::internal::Isolateprivate
MarkCompactEpilogue(bool is_compacting, ThreadLocalTop *archived_thread_data)v8::internal::Isolateprivate
MarkCompactPrologue(bool is_compacting, ThreadLocalTop *archived_thread_data)v8::internal::Isolateprivate
materialized_object_store()v8::internal::Isolateinline
materialized_object_store_v8::internal::Isolateprivate
MayIndexedAccess(Handle< JSObject > receiver, uint32_t index, v8::AccessType type)v8::internal::Isolate
MayNamedAccess(Handle< JSObject > receiver, Handle< Object > key, v8::AccessType type)v8::internal::Isolate
memory_allocator()v8::internal::Isolateinline
memory_allocator_v8::internal::Isolateprivate
native_context()v8::internal::Isolate
NewForTesting()v8::internal::Isolateinlinestatic
next_optimization_id_v8::internal::Isolateprivate
NextOptimizationId()v8::internal::Isolateinline
NO_INLINE(void PushStackTraceAndDie(unsigned int magic, Object *object, Map *map, unsigned int magic2))v8::internal::Isolate
NotifyExtensionInstalled()v8::internal::Isolateinline
num_sweeper_threads() constv8::internal::Isolateinline
num_sweeper_threads_v8::internal::Isolateprivate
objects_string_compare_iterator_a()v8::internal::Isolateinline
objects_string_compare_iterator_a_v8::internal::Isolateprivate
objects_string_compare_iterator_b()v8::internal::Isolateinline
objects_string_compare_iterator_b_v8::internal::Isolateprivate
objects_string_iterator()v8::internal::Isolateinline
objects_string_iterator_v8::internal::Isolateprivate
optimizing_compiler_thread()v8::internal::Isolateinline
optimizing_compiler_thread_v8::internal::Isolateprivate
OptimizingCompilerThread classv8::internal::Isolatefriend
OptionalRescheduleException(bool is_bottom_call)v8::internal::Isolate
pending_exception()v8::internal::Isolateinline
pending_exception_address()v8::internal::Isolateinline
pending_message_obj_address()v8::internal::Isolateinline
pending_message_script_address()v8::internal::Isolateinline
per_isolate_thread_data_key()v8::internal::Isolatestatic
per_isolate_thread_data_key_v8::internal::Isolateprivatestatic
PopPromise()v8::internal::Isolate
PrintCurrentStackTrace(FILE *out)v8::internal::Isolate
PrintStack(StringStream *accumulator)v8::internal::Isolate
PrintStack(FILE *out)v8::internal::Isolate
PromoteScheduledException()v8::internal::Isolate
PropagatePendingExceptionToExternalTryCatch()v8::internal::Isolateprivate
PushPromise(Handle< JSObject > promise)v8::internal::Isolate
PushToPartialSnapshotCache(Object *obj)v8::internal::Isolate
random_number_generator()v8::internal::Isolateinline
random_number_generator_v8::internal::Isolateprivate
regexp_macro_assembler_canonicalize()v8::internal::Isolateinline
regexp_macro_assembler_canonicalize_v8::internal::Isolateprivate
regexp_stack()v8::internal::Isolateinline
regexp_stack_v8::internal::Isolateprivate
RegisterTryCatchHandler(v8::TryCatch *that)v8::internal::Isolate
RemoveCallCompletedCallback(CallCompletedCallback callback)v8::internal::Isolate
ReportFailedAccessCheck(Handle< JSObject > receiver, v8::AccessType type)v8::internal::Isolate
ReportPendingMessages()v8::internal::Isolate
RestorePendingMessageFromTryCatch(v8::TryCatch *handler)v8::internal::Isolate
RestoreThread(char *from)v8::internal::Isolate
ReThrow(Object *exception)v8::internal::Isolate
RunMicrotasks()v8::internal::Isolate
runtime_profiler()v8::internal::Isolateinline
runtime_profiler_v8::internal::Isolateprivate
runtime_state()v8::internal::Isolateinline
runtime_state_v8::internal::Isolateprivate
runtime_zone()v8::internal::Isolateinline
runtime_zone_v8::internal::Isolateprivate
scheduled_exception()v8::internal::Isolateinline
scheduled_exception_address()v8::internal::Isolateinline
ScheduleThrow(Object *exception)v8::internal::Isolate
serializer_enabled() constv8::internal::Isolateinline
serializer_enabled_v8::internal::Isolateprivate
set_context(Context *context)v8::internal::Isolateinline
set_date_cache(DateCache *date_cache)v8::internal::Isolateinline
set_function_entry_hook(FunctionEntryHook function_entry_hook)v8::internal::Isolateinline
set_pending_exception(Object *exception_obj)v8::internal::Isolateinline
SetCaptureStackTraceForUncaughtExceptions(bool capture, int frame_limit, StackTrace::StackTraceOptions options)v8::internal::Isolate
SetData(uint32_t slot, void *data)v8::internal::Isolateinline
SetFailedAccessCheckCallback(v8::FailedAccessCheckCallback callback)v8::internal::Isolate
SetIsolateThreadLocals(Isolate *isolate, PerIsolateThreadData *data)v8::internal::Isolateprivatestatic
SetUseCounterCallback(v8::Isolate::UseCounterCallback callback)v8::internal::Isolate
ShouldReportException(bool *can_be_caught_externally, bool catchable_by_javascript)v8::internal::Isolate
SignalFatalError()v8::internal::Isolateinline
Simulator classv8::internal::Isolatefriend
stack_guard()v8::internal::Isolateinline
stack_guard_v8::internal::Isolateprivate
stack_trace_for_uncaught_exceptions_frame_limit_v8::internal::Isolateprivate
stack_trace_for_uncaught_exceptions_options_v8::internal::Isolateprivate
stack_trace_nesting_level_v8::internal::Isolateprivate
StackGuard classv8::internal::Isolatefriend
StackOverflow()v8::internal::Isolate
StackTraceString()v8::internal::Isolate
State enum namev8::internal::Isolateprivate
state_v8::internal::Isolateprivate
stats_table()v8::internal::Isolate
stats_table_v8::internal::Isolateprivate
stress_deopt_count_v8::internal::Isolateprivate
stress_deopt_count_address()v8::internal::Isolateinline
string_tracker()v8::internal::Isolateinline
string_tracker_v8::internal::Isolateprivate
stub_cache()v8::internal::Isolateinline
stub_cache_v8::internal::Isolateprivate
sweeper_thread_v8::internal::Isolateprivate
sweeper_threads()v8::internal::Isolateinline
SweeperThread classv8::internal::Isolatefriend
TearDown()v8::internal::Isolate
TerminateExecution()v8::internal::Isolate
TestCodeRangeScope classv8::internal::Isolatefriend
TestMemoryAllocatorScope classv8::internal::Isolatefriend
thread_data_table_v8::internal::Isolateprivatestatic
thread_data_table_mutex_v8::internal::Isolateprivatestatic
thread_id_key()v8::internal::Isolateinlinestatic
thread_id_key_v8::internal::Isolateprivatestatic
thread_local_top()v8::internal::Isolateinline
thread_local_top_v8::internal::Isolateprivate
thread_manager()v8::internal::Isolateinline
thread_manager_v8::internal::Isolateprivate
ThreadId classv8::internal::Isolatefriend
ThreadManager classv8::internal::Isolatefriend
Throw(Object *exception, MessageLocation *location=NULL)v8::internal::Isolate
Throw(Handle< Object > exception, MessageLocation *location=NULL)v8::internal::Isolateinline
ThrowIllegalOperation()v8::internal::Isolate
time_millis_at_init_v8::internal::Isolateprivate
time_millis_since_init()v8::internal::Isolateinline
try_catch_handler()v8::internal::Isolateinline
try_catch_handler_address()v8::internal::Isolateinline
unicode_cache()v8::internal::Isolateinline
unicode_cache_v8::internal::Isolateprivate
UNINITIALIZED enum valuev8::internal::Isolateprivate
UnlinkDeferredHandles(DeferredHandles *deferred_handles)v8::internal::Isolate
UnregisterTryCatchHandler(v8::TryCatch *that)v8::internal::Isolate
use_counter_callback_v8::internal::Isolateprivate
use_crankshaft() constv8::internal::Isolate
v8::Isolate classv8::internal::Isolatefriend
v8::Locker classv8::internal::Isolatefriend
v8::Unlocker classv8::internal::Isolatefriend
write_iterator()v8::internal::Isolateinline
write_iterator_v8::internal::Isolateprivate
~Isolate()v8::internal::Isolate